We were given a room upgrade when we booked in so great start. The room was on the 5th floor with a pool and sea view and had 2 small double beds, a sofa bed and plenty of wardrobe space. There was a reasonable size balcony with table and 2 chairs. The air con worked well as did the wifi. The beds were really comfortable and there was plenty of hot water. Obviously it is an older hotel so the room decor is a little dated but well cleaned. Our cleaner was excellent and friendly. There are 3 pools to choose from, one large with slides. The beach is a short walk away and has plenty of sun beds, seating, a bar and snacks. If you have walking difficulties the hotel will drive you down in a golf cart. It’s probably best to go early to secure a sun bed. All the staff are very friendly and helpful and there is entertainment every night at the roof bar. Ali runs a small beauty salon in the hotel and I had a manicure and nails painted for a good price. The food is average but as we spoke to different people from 13 different countries it’s obvious that the hotel can’t please everyone all the time. If you fancy a change there are lots of reasonably priced restaurants in Naama bay. Being centrally placed in Naama Bay you are close to the shops and the beach and promenade. People will try to get you into their shops but it’s generally good humoured. If you want souvenirs there is an arcade next to Macdonalds with fixed prices and no hassle. La is Arabic for no, and a downward cut with the hand emphasises it. There are plenty of trips from Sharm that are worth doing and can be booked in town. If you want a quieter beach walk a little further along the promenade to the Kanabesh beach where you can pay for sun beds and towels (reasonable). The food at their beach bar is excellent - great pizzas. All things considered we had an excellent and relaxing holiday and would happily stay at the hotel again. The staff and brilliant and can’t do enough for you. We both had birthdays during the week and were given cakes. We also had a complimentary meal at the Boharat Restaurant- superb.
